The cheapest way to get from Udine (Station) to Bibione is to bus which costs €5 - €9 and takes 1h 5m.
The fastest way to get from Udine (Station) to Bibione is to drive which takes 1h 1m and costs €9 - €13.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Udine and arriving at Bibione. Services depart twice da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 1h 5m.
The distance between Udine (Station) and Bibione is 58 km. The road distance is 57.4 km.
The best way to get from Udine (Station) to Bibione without a car is to bus which takes 1h 5m and costs €5 - €9.
The bus from Udine to Bibione takes 1h 5m including transfers and departs twice daily.
Udine (Station) to Bibione b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Udine station.
Udine (Station) to Bibione b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Bibione station.
Yes, the driving distance between Udine (Station) to Bibione is 57 km. It takes approximately 1h 1m to drive from Udine (Station) to Bibione.
